Transaction 72afa36e5b101b88d3771b2b7c77e71d51d61e985425823dde2e941212e0acf4

1 Input
2 Outputs
  • 72afa36e5b101b88d3771b2b7c77e71d51d61e985425823dde2e941212e0acf4:0
  • value  1030000
    address  1NUrFJbfgbets1VZYvV37RjTJDzJpPYSte
  • 72afa36e5b101b88d3771b2b7c77e71d51d61e985425823dde2e941212e0acf4:1
  • value  405644839
    address  3NRbeX3vD5VaVE4TDU9ivCDsEf7NPPte6J